Output 6cc34fcc0ce05d8cea58a8d41d4b9e0650a80426b4dbad80ae4300a3b0825782:0

value
2650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58005bdef1cd7b94f4866f8a5148b825f1148394 OP_EQUAL
address
39iKpMowZjCogVZpfc5E5jAo5N4R38W1TA
transaction
6cc34fcc0ce05d8cea58a8d41d4b9e0650a80426b4dbad80ae4300a3b0825782
confirmations
199917
spent
true